SUMMARY:Life Insurance Across Europe - An Overview from an Actuarial Perspective
DESCRIPTION:While life insurance across Europe serves similar fundamental purposes\, its practical implementation varies significantly across jurisdictions. Each market is shaped by its own regulatory framework\, tax environment\, product design traditions\, and demographic dynamics. \nThis seminar aims to broaden perspectives beyond national boundaries by providing a structured\, comparative overview of European life insurance markets. Selected countries will be examined with a focus on typical products\, regulatory and legal frameworks\, pricing and reserving methodologies\, and the key current and emerging challenges for actuaries. \nSpeakers: \n\nGermany: Alexander Kling\, ifa Ulm\nSwitzerland: Frank Genheimer\, new insurance business\nFrance: TBD\nItaly: Federico Scamperle\, Assicurazioni Generali S.p.A.\nUK: TBD\nDenmark: Sam Achord\, PensionDanmark\nFinland: Esko Kivisaari\nPoland: Pawel Sikora\, Vienna Life\nSlowakia: Maria Kamenarova\nHungary: TBD\nOverview over other Eastern European countries: Laszlo Koltai\, Vienna Insurance Group\n\nType of event: online via MS-Teams\nLanguage of the event: English\nCosts: 150 EUR for both half-days\nCPD-Points (Austria): 6 Points\, IDD-Credits: 6 (Module 2)\nDates: \n\nThursday\, 25 June\, 9:00–12:30 (CEST)\nMonday\, 29 June\, 14:00–17:30 (CEST)\n\n\nTarget group:\nThe seminar is primarily aimed at actuaries\, and all speakers are actuaries\, but the presentations will not dig into actuarial details. It is also well-suited for other interested professionals\, such as staff in insurance accounting or controlling\, sales agents\, brokers\, and marketing professionals. \nContents:\nThis online seminar is aimed at providing Actuaries with insights into life insurance markets across Europe. The objective is to move beyond a purely national perspective and to develop a broader understanding of product design\, regulatory frameworks\, and actuarial practices in different countries. \nFrom a variety of countries well-known speakers will join us\, covering key aspects of the respective market. These include typical life insurance products (such as traditional\, unit-linked\, protection\, and pension products)\, main target groups\, as well as legal and supervisory requirements and tax treatment. In addition\, topics such as profit participation mechanisms\, minimum biometric risk requirements\, pricing practices (including cost structures)\, and reserving approaches will be addressed. Further country-specific features may also be included to provide a comprehensive overview of the structure and particularities of each market. \nAbout the Speakers:\nFrank Genheimer is Managing Director and Partner at New Insurance Business (Switzerland).
